Every few years (yes, years) we revisit the idea of carrying The Stranger's "Savage Love." Written by editorial director Dan Savage, "Savage Love" is ... well, the kind of column your mother probably wouldn't approve of. And not just because it's about sex but because it's about sex the way you'd talk about it with your closest friends if you were capable of having a really frank discussion and didn't mind a few expletives thrown in for good measure.
Savage sat on one of the panels I attended at BW's annual trade association conference in Tucson last month, and it got me thinking about the idea of carrying Savage Love again. Now that I read through the archive and refresh my memory, I'm not so sure Boise can handle him.
